Hubbs was on the radio this morning and said two things:

(1) Dobbs has never competed with Worley for the starting QB job. Dobbs had a poor Spring (except for the OW game) and was very inconsistent in the Fall camp.
(2) Peterman was also not much competition for Worley, but is more consistent than Dobbs.
